What are GLP-1 Receptor Agonists?
GLP-1 is a hormonal agent naturally produced in the intestinal tracts. It plays a critical function in regulating blood sugar level levels and cravings. GLP-1 receptor agonists are artificial variations of this hormone that last longer in the body than the natural variation.
They function through three main mechanisms:
Insulin Secretion: They stimulate the pancreas to release insulin when blood sugar level is high.Glucagon Suppression: They avoid the liver from releasing too much sugar into the bloodstream.Satiety Regulation: They sluggish stomach emptying and signal the brain that the body is "full," leading to decreased calorie consumption.The Legal Framework: Buying GLP-1 in Germany
In Germany, all GLP-1 medications are classified as Verschreibungspflichtig (prescription-only). It is prohibited to acquire these medications over-the-counter (OTC) or from unapproved GLP-1-Rezepte online in Deutschland vendors. The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ices (BfArM) strictly keeps track of the distribution of these drugs to ensure patient safety and to manage supply shortages.
The Role of the Physician
To buy GLP-1 in Germany, a patient must first undergo a medical consultation. A physician (normally a GP, endocrinologist, or diabetologist) will evaluate the patient's Body Mass Index (BMI), co-morbidities (such as hypertension or sleep apnea), and blood work.

The Cost Structure and Insurance Coverage
One of the most complex elements of buying GLP-1 medications in Germany is browsing the insurance coverage system. Germany runs on a dual system of Statutory Health Insurance (Gesetzliche Krankenversicherung - GKV) and Private Health Insurance (Private Krankenversicherung - PKV).
1. Statutory Health Insurance (GKV)
For clients with Type 2 Diabetes, the GKV normally covers the expense of medications like Ozempic or Rybelsus, based on a small co-payment (typically EUR5 to EUR10).
Nevertheless, for weight reduction (obesity treatment), the circumstance is various. Under present German law (SGB V), weight loss medications are frequently classified as "lifestyle drugs." This suggests that even if a medical professional recommends Wegovy for obesity, the GKV is presently restricted from covering the costs. Clients must pay the complete list price expense by means of a "Privatrezept" (personal prescription).
2. Private Health Insurance (PKV)
Private insurance providers have more versatility. Some PKV companies cover medications like Wegovy if the patient meets specific scientific requirements (e.g., a BMI over 30 and failed previous lifestyle interventions). It is vital for clients to consult their particular provider before beginning treatment.

The "GLP1 Buy Germany" search typically results in unauthorized sites offering these drugs without a prescription. The German authorities (BfArM) have actually provided a number of cautions relating to counterfeit Ozempic pens going into the European market.
Threats of Unauthorized Sellers:Counterfeit Product: The substance might be impure, improperly dosed, or consist of completely various ingredients like insulin, which can trigger deadly hypoglycemia.Absence of Cold Chain: GLP-1 medications should be cooled. Prohibited sellers typically overlook the "cold chain," rendering the medication inadequate or hazardous.Legal Consequences: Importing prescription medication without a valid prescription is an offense of the German Medicines Act (Arzneimittelgesetz).Future Outlook: Supply and Regulation

Can I buy Ozempic in Germany for weight loss?
While Ozempic consists of Semaglutide, in Germany it is specifically authorized for Type 2 Diabetes. Physicians might prescribe it "off-label" for weight loss, however provided the existing lacks, authorities recommend using Wegovy, which is particularly approved and identified for weight problems treatment.
2. Is Wegovy covered by the "Krankenkasse" (public insurance coverage)?
Usually, no. Since early 2024, medications primarily utilized for weight reduction are omitted from repayment by statutory medical insurance under German law.

5. Are there oral GLP-1 alternatives in Germany?
Yes, Semaglutide is offered GLP-1-Therapie in Deutschland tablet kind under the trademark name Rybelsus. It is currently authorized for the treatment of Type 2 Diabetes.
